People are seeing glimpses of the Machali in tigress Riddhi – the great granddaughter of the Machali. Tigress Riddhi is now behaving and following the path of her great-grandmother.

In Ranthambore National Park, Riddhi came into the limelight due to the clash with her mother Tigress Arrowhead over Territory. Tigress Arrowhead gave birth to two female cubs two years ago, named Riddhi and Siddhi. Riddhi is just two years old and is looking for her own separate territory. According to nature guides, tigress Riddhi has been naughty since childhood. Riddhi has been seen fighting with her sister many times as she is getting older. She is trying to establish her own territory and keeping herself separate from mother. For this reason, she has struggled with her mother many times which has been reported recently. This area is the heart of Ranthambore

Ranthambore National Park is a beautiful area, which is divided into ten zones.  This area, full of waterfalls and ponds, is called the heart of Ranthambore. This is the area where the Machali ruled for years and after that his daughter Sundari evicted and captured. Later, Sundari’s daughter Krishna evicted her own mother Sundari from her muscle power and ruled her territory. With the passage of time, Krishna’s daughter Arrowhead, after repeating the story, banished her mother and started ruling the hearts of Ranthambore. Over time Arrowhead gave birth to two female cubs and now she turns 2. The daughter Riddhi, who is young growing tigress, is also trying to snatch the territory of her mother by repeating the history. The Ranthambore National Park has taken its name from the famous Ranthambore Fort which is situated within the park. The park is located in the district of Sawai Madhopur in Rajasthan and at the distance of around 11 km from the Sawai Madhopur railway station. Sawai Madhopur is approx 130 km away from the capital of Rajasthan, Jaipur.
